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Enhance Dashboard with Dark Mode Toggle and Sidebar Functionality #543

Closed
3 tasks done
ak-0404 opened this issue Oct 12, 2024 · 5 comments
Closed
3 tasks done

Enhance Dashboard with Dark Mode Toggle and Sidebar Functionality #543

ak-0404 opened this issue Oct 12, 2024 · 5 comments

Comments

@ak-0404
Copy link

ak-0404 commented Oct 12, 2024

Describe the feature

This enhanced JavaScript code provides a smooth toggle between light and dark modes using a single function for the sun and moon buttons, with the user’s preference saved in local storage for persistence. It also allows users to toggle a sidebar menu that slides in and out with smooth transitions. Additionally, keyboard shortcuts are included for accessibility, enabling users to toggle dark mode (using the "d" key) and the sidebar (using the "m" key).

Add ScreenShots

-Original Code
buddyimg1

-Modified Code
LIGHT MODE
buddyimg1

DARK MODE
buddyimg2

Record

  • I agree to follow this project's Code of Conduct
  • I'm a GSSOC'24 contributor
  • I want to work on this issue
Copy link
Contributor

Thanks for creating the issue in BuddyTrail!
Before you start working on your PR, please make sure to:

  • ⭐ Star the repository if you haven't already.
  • Pull the latest changes to avoid any merge conflicts.
  • Attach before & after screenshots in your PR for clarity.
  • Include the issue number in your PR description for better tracking.
    Don't forget to follow @PriyaGhosal – Project Admin – for more updates!

We're excited to see your contribution as part of GSSOC Extended Edition 2024 and Hacktoberfest! 🎉
Happy open-source contributing!

Copy link
Contributor

Thank you for creating this issue! 🎉 Your issue will soon be reviewed by either the PA or a mentor. Please note that Level 1 is temporary and can be changed during the review. In the meantime, please make sure to provide all the necessary details and context. If you have any questions or additional information, feel free to add them here. Your contributions are highly appreciated! 😊

You can also check our CONTRIBUTING.md for guidelines on contributing to this project.

@ak-0404
Copy link
Author

ak-0404 commented Oct 12, 2024

@PriyaGhosal Please assign this issue to me, Thank You! :))

Copy link
Contributor

Hello @ak-0404! Your issue #543 has been closed. Thank you for your contribution!

@ak-0404
Copy link
Author

ak-0404 commented Oct 28, 2024

hello @PriyaGhosal can u please reopen this issue? i have fixed the bugs in the code and am ready to merge, thank you!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ants